The overall rate coefficient k of the self recombination of BrO radicals has been measured at 298 K with use of the discharge flow/mass spectrometry technique. The rate coefficient k 2 for the reaction channel forming Br 2 has been also determined. The results are: k = (3.2 ± 0.5) × 10 −12 and k 2 = (4.7 ± 1.5) × 10 −13 (in cm 3 molecule −1 s −1 ). These results are discussed with respect to previous literature data.
